Ignoring market research

One of the biggest mistakes that businesses in the personal protective equipment industry can make is ignoring market research. Market research is essential for understanding the needs and preferences of your target customers, identifying trends in the industry, and staying ahead of the competition. By neglecting market research, businesses risk investing time and resources into products that may not meet the demands of the market or missing out on lucrative opportunities.

Here are some key reasons why ignoring market research can be detrimental to a personal protective equipment business like SafeGuard Essentials:

  • Lack of understanding of customer needs: Without conducting market research, businesses may not fully understand the specific needs and preferences of their target customers. This can result in offering products that do not meet the requirements of the market, leading to low sales and customer dissatisfaction.
  • Missed opportunities: Market research helps businesses identify emerging trends, new market segments, and potential opportunities for growth. Ignoring market research can result in missing out on these opportunities and falling behind competitors who are more attuned to market dynamics.
  • Increased risk of product failure: Developing and launching new products without conducting market research can be risky. Without understanding market demand, pricing expectations, and competitive landscape, businesses may invest in products that fail to gain traction in the market, leading to financial losses.
  • Ineffective marketing strategies: Market research provides valuable insights into the most effective marketing channels, messaging, and strategies to reach and engage target customers. Ignoring market research can result in ineffective marketing campaigns that fail to resonate with the intended audience.
  • Difficulty in adapting to market changes: Markets are constantly evolving, with new competitors entering the space, consumer preferences shifting, and regulatory changes impacting the industry. By ignoring market research, businesses may struggle to adapt to these changes and may find themselves at a disadvantage.

For SafeGuard Essentials to succeed in the competitive personal protective equipment market, it is crucial to prioritize market research. By understanding the needs of customers, staying informed about industry trends, and being proactive in identifying opportunities, SafeGuard Essentials can position itself as a leader in the industry and meet the evolving demands of its target markets.

Overlooking product quality

One of the most critical mistakes that businesses in the personal protective equipment industry can make is overlooking product quality. In an industry where the safety and well-being of individuals are at stake, the quality of the PPE being provided should be the top priority.

When businesses prioritize quantity over quality, they run the risk of providing ineffective or substandard protective equipment to their customers. This not only puts individuals at risk but can also damage the reputation and credibility of the business.

It is essential for businesses in the PPE industry, such as SafeGuard Essentials, to thoroughly vet their suppliers and manufacturers to ensure that the products being offered meet the highest standards of quality and safety. This includes conducting regular quality control checks, testing the products against industry standards, and staying up-to-date on the latest advancements in PPE technology.

By investing in high-quality materials and manufacturing processes, businesses can ensure that their products provide maximum protection and comfort to the end-users. This not only enhances the safety of individuals but also builds trust and loyalty among customers.

Furthermore, businesses should listen to customer feedback and be willing to make improvements to their products based on real-world usage and experiences. This continuous feedback loop helps businesses stay ahead of the curve and ensures that their products remain relevant and effective in the ever-evolving landscape of PPE.

In conclusion, overlooking product quality is a grave mistake that businesses in the PPE industry cannot afford to make. By prioritizing quality, investing in rigorous testing and quality control measures, and listening to customer feedback, businesses can ensure that they are providing the best possible protection to their customers and maintaining a strong reputation in the market.

Underestimating supply chain challenges

One of the common mistakes that businesses in the personal protective equipment industry make is underestimating the supply chain challenges they may face. In the case of SafeGuard Essentials, a thorough understanding of the supply chain dynamics is crucial to ensure a seamless flow of products to customers.

Here are some key considerations to avoid underestimating the supply chain challenges:

  • Forecasting: Accurate forecasting of demand is essential to prevent shortages or excess inventory. SafeGuard Essentials must analyze historical data, market trends, and customer preferences to predict future demand accurately.
  • Supplier Relationships: Building strong relationships with reliable suppliers is critical for maintaining a steady supply of high-quality PPE. SafeGuard Essentials should establish clear communication channels, negotiate favorable terms, and have backup suppliers in place.
  • Inventory Management: Effective inventory management practices, such as just-in-time inventory and safety stock levels, can help prevent stockouts and minimize carrying costs. SafeGuard Essentials must implement robust inventory tracking systems to monitor stock levels and reorder supplies in a timely manner.
  • Logistics: Efficient logistics operations are essential for timely delivery of products to customers. SafeGuard Essentials should optimize transportation routes, warehouse operations, and distribution networks to ensure fast and cost-effective delivery of PPE.
  • Risk Management: Anticipating and mitigating potential risks, such as natural disasters, supplier disruptions, or regulatory changes, is crucial for maintaining a resilient supply chain. SafeGuard Essentials should develop contingency plans and diversify sourcing to minimize the impact of unforeseen events.

By proactively addressing these supply chain challenges, SafeGuard Essentials can ensure a reliable supply of high-quality PPE to meet the growing demand from various industries and customers.

Skipping compliance and standards

One of the most critical mistakes to avoid in the personal protective equipment business is skipping compliance and standards. Ensuring that your products meet all necessary regulations and standards is essential for the safety and protection of your customers. Failure to comply with these requirements can not only result in legal consequences but also put lives at risk.

When it comes to PPE, there are specific standards and regulations that must be followed to guarantee the effectiveness of the equipment. This includes requirements for materials used, design specifications, and performance testing. By skipping or overlooking these compliance measures, you are jeopardizing the quality and reliability of your products.

It is important to stay informed about the latest industry standards and regulations to ensure that your PPE meets all necessary requirements. This may involve regular testing and certification processes to validate the effectiveness of your products. Compliance with these standards not only demonstrates your commitment to safety but also builds trust with your customers.

Additionally, failing to comply with regulations can result in costly recalls, fines, and damage to your reputation. In the competitive PPE market, reputation is everything, and any misstep in compliance can have long-lasting consequences for your business.

By prioritizing compliance and standards in your personal protective equipment business, you are not only protecting your customers but also safeguarding the future success of your company. Invest in quality assurance processes, stay up-to-date on regulations, and prioritize safety above all else to avoid the costly mistake of skipping compliance and standards.

Misjudging demand forecasting

One of the critical aspects of running a successful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) business like SafeGuard Essentials is accurately forecasting demand for your products. Misjudging demand forecasting can lead to significant challenges such as stockouts, excess inventory, lost sales, and ultimately, dissatisfied customers. Here are some key points to consider to avoid mistakes in demand forecasting:

  • Utilize historical data: One of the most effective ways to forecast demand is by analyzing historical sales data. Look at past trends, seasonality, and any external factors that may have influenced demand. By understanding your sales patterns, you can make more informed decisions about future demand.
  • Consider market trends: Stay informed about industry trends, market conditions, and any regulatory changes that may impact the demand for PPE. For example, during a global health crisis like the COVID-19 pandemic, the demand for masks and other protective gear skyrocketed. Being aware of such trends can help you anticipate and prepare for fluctuations in demand.
  • Engage with customers: Regularly communicate with your customers to gather feedback on their needs and preferences. Understanding their requirements can help you tailor your product offerings and forecast demand more accurately. Customer surveys, focus groups, and social media interactions can provide valuable insights into consumer behavior.
  • Collaborate with suppliers: Build strong relationships with your suppliers and keep them informed about your demand forecasts. By working closely with your suppliers, you can ensure a steady supply of inventory to meet customer demand. Collaborating with suppliers can also help you negotiate better pricing and terms, reducing the risk of stockouts or excess inventory.
  • Use forecasting tools: Leverage advanced forecasting tools and software to analyze data, identify patterns, and generate accurate demand forecasts. These tools can help you automate the forecasting process, reduce human error, and improve the accuracy of your predictions. Invest in technology that aligns with your business needs and goals.

By paying close attention to demand forecasting and implementing these strategies, SafeGuard Essentials can better anticipate market demand, optimize inventory levels, and deliver exceptional customer service. Avoiding mistakes in demand forecasting is essential for the success and sustainability of your PPE business.
